The band:

RealDrums in style: BluesMondaySw8^01-a:Sidestick, HiHat , b:Sidestick, Ride
RealTracks in style: 564:Bass, Electric, Blues Monday Sw 065
RealTracks in style: ~675:Organ, B3, Background Blues Monday Sw 065

Guitar tracks (three) are from me.

Mixed with reaper with plugins from Waves and iZotope, mastered with ozone 8 and LMC.
